NLC India


The company’s joint venture with UP Rajya Vidyut Utpadan Nigam has started coal production at the Pachwara South coal block. The block has extractable coal reserves of 264.84 million tonnes, with a normative mining capacity of 9 million tonnes per annum and an average coal grade of G10.


Neyveli Uttar Pradesh Power (NUPPL), a joint venture of NLC India and UP Rajya Vidyut Utpadan Nigam with a 51:49 equity shareholding, is establishing a 3x660 MW Ghatampur Thermal Power Plant at Ghatampur. To meet the fuel requirements of the said power plant, the Pachwara South coal block was allotted to the company by the Ministry of Coal.


GR Infraprojects


The company has emerged as the L1 bidder for an NHAI project worth Rs 1,453.57 crore in Gujarat. The project involves the upgradation of an existing two-lane carriageway to a four-lane carriageway.


Additionally, the company has received a contract worth Rs 413.37 crore from NTPC for the implementation of Battery Energy Storage Systems (BESS) at the Mouda Super Thermal Power Station, including services, ex-works (India) supply, and comprehensive annual maintenance for the entire design life of the BESS system.

Coal India


The company has received a Letter of Award (LoA) from Telangana Power Generation Corporation for setting up a 750 MWh (187.5 MW for 4 hours) BESS plant at Choutuppal, at a tariff of Rs 3.14 lakh per MW per month. The project cost is Rs 1,057.09 crore.


Additionally, the company has formed a 50:50 joint venture, DVC CIL Power Private Limited, with Damodar Valley Corporation.


CMS Info Systems


The company has announced the acquisition of the ATM managed services business of Financial Software and Systems (FSS) for Rs 115 crore. The transaction involves the transfer of operating assets and the novation of customer contracts, and is expected to close in Q1 FY27.


Additionally, PPFAS Mutual Fund, through its schemes, acquired 1.5 lakh shares via an open market transaction on March 24, increasing its shareholding to 7.97 percent from 7.88 percent earlier.


NTPC


The board approved the company’s investment proposal for Battery Energy Storage Systems (BESS) with a total capacity of 4.70 GWh, at an estimated project cost of Rs 5,821.90 crore.


It also approved an additional equity commitment of Rs 3,173.67 crore in Meja Urja Nigam (MUNPL), a joint venture of NTPC and Uttar Pradesh Rajya Vidyut Utpadan Nigam (UPRVUNL), for setting up the Meja Super Thermal Power Project Stage-II (3x800 MW). With this investment, the total equity commitment in MUNPL would reach Rs 5,000 crore.


Additionally, the company’s subsidiary, NTPC Renewable Energy, has declared COD for 180 MW solar capacity. With this, the total installed capacity of the NTPC group stands at 88,889 MW and the commercial capacity at 87,809 MW.

ACME Solar Holdings


The company has received a show-cause-cum-demand notice from the Directorate General of Goods & Services Tax Intelligence, Rajasthan, alleging a GST demand of Rs 149.73 crore for the period from April 2021 to March 2025, along with applicable interest and penalties.


Additionally, through its subsidiary ACME Surya Power, the company has commissioned the third phase of 11.429 MW / 51.354 MWh out of the total 250 MW / 1103.392 MWh BESS project capacity at Bikaner, Rajasthan.


The commercial operation date (COD) for Phase III will be March 31, 2026. With this, ACME Surya Power has achieved a commissioned capacity of 107.143 MW / 481.440 MWh out of the total planned capacity.


Bank of Baroda


The Government of Madhya Pradesh has revoked a five-year ban on Bank of Baroda from conducting state government business within 24 hours of issuing the initial order, according to CNBC-TV18.


The initial order, issued by the Madhya Pradesh Institutional Finance Commissioner on March 27, cited alleged lapses in handling funds under the Chief Minister Kisan Yojana. According to the government letter, approximately Rs 1,751 crore was required to be deposited under a specific treasury receipt head.
